Plan Your Shoot: Timing, Permits, and Weather
Scout nights and moon phases to maximize Milky Way visibility while minimizing light pollution. Yosemite photography needs timing, patience, and local awareness.
Best Months and Moon Phases
Late spring through early fall offers Milky Way cores visible after midnight. Check moon calendars and aim for new moon windows for darkest skies.
Pack for temperature swings: high desert nights can be chilly, so bring layers and a headlamp with red mode to preserve night vision.
Permits, Park Rules, and Safety
Confirm any permit requirements for night operations, tripod use, or commercial photography within Yosemite National Park boundaries to avoid fines.
Stay on trails, register in trailhead logs, and let someone know your route. Wildlife and cliffs demand vigilance during long night shoots.
Essential Gear for Nightscapes and Long Exposures
Bring a sturdy tripod, wide fast lens, and remote release. Yosemite photography benefits from stable support and precise control over exposures.
- Camera: full-frame or APS-C with good high-ISO performance.
- Lenses: 14–24mm or 16–35mm f/2.8 for wide Milky Way arcs.
- Accessories: spare batteries, headlamp, intervalometer.
Tripod and Stabilization Tips
Use a low-center-of-gravity tripod and tighten all locks before a long exposure. Wind on exposed cliffs can ruin a single frame.
Weigh the tripod with a bag or use ground spikes on soft soil to keep stability during 30s and stacked exposures.
Camera Settings and Exposure Basics
Start with manual mode: 30s exposure, wide aperture (f/2.8), ISO 1600–6400. Adjust based on noise and histogram clipping.
For star trails, layer multiple shorter exposures and stack to minimize noise while preserving movement and arc clarity.

Composition Strategies: El Capitan, Glacier Point, and Classic Vistas
Compose with foreground elements—trees, boulders, or reflections—to anchor the Milky Way arcs. Yosemite photography thrives on scale and emotion.
Foreground Selection and Depth
Include recognizable features like El Capitan to give viewers a sense of scale against the starry sky. Use wide-angle distortion intentionally.
Illuminate foreground subtly with low-level flash or warm LED to create separation without overpowering the stars.
Balancing Sky and Land
Use the rule of thirds or a low horizon to emphasize the Milky Way arc. A lower horizon accentuates the celestial sweep and star trails.
Bracket exposures for a blended final image if the foreground requires different exposure than the sky for a seamless composite.
Night Techniques: Star Trails, Milky Way Arcs, and Stacking
To capture star trails near El Capitan or Glacier Point, try 30s exposures to preserve Milky Way arcs while building trails through stacking. Yosemite photography rewards layered techniques.
- Use intervalometer: continuous 30s shots for 30–90 minutes.
- Stack images in software to reduce noise and produce smooth trails.
- Blend a short-exposure sky with a long-exposure foreground for clarity.
Single Long Exposure Vs. Stacked Method
Single long exposures (30+ minutes) create continuous trails but increase noise and sensor heat. Stacking many 30s frames is cleaner.
Stacking also allows removal of satellites and airplanes by using median or dark frame techniques during post-processing.
Recommended Post-processing Workflow
Align and stack star frames in specialized software, then process Luminance and Color separately to preserve Milky Way detail and minimize noise.
Blend foreground exposures using luminosity masks and gentle dodging to maintain a natural, immersive final image.

Daytime Yosemite Photography: Waterfalls, Light, and Drama
Golden hour transforms Yosemite’s cliffs and waterfalls. Yosemite photography during daylight requires ND filters, compositions, and patience for peak light.
- Arrive early to secure vantage points and compositions.
- Use ND filters for silky waterfall effects at midday.
- Bracket exposures to preserve highlight detail in falls and sky.
- Compose with leading lines to invite viewers into the scene.
Waterfall Techniques and Shutter Control
Use 0.5–2 second exposures for gentle flow, or longer for dreamy silk effects. Tripod and remote shutter help avoid camera shake.
Neutral density filters allow longer exposures in bright light while maintaining appropriate ISO and aperture settings.
Managing Crowds and Timing
Shoot early morning or late afternoon to avoid tourist congestion at popular viewpoints like Tunnel View and Bridalveil Fall.
Patience pays: wait for hikers to move and for changing light to reveal textures on granite and water highlights.

What Camera Settings Work Best for Milky Way Arcs in Yosemite Photography?
Use manual mode: 30s shutter, wide aperture (f/2.8), and ISO 1600–6400. Adjust ISO to manage noise while keeping the histogram away from clipping. For wide lenses, test shorter exposures to prevent star trailing. Bracket and stack when possible for best results.
Are Permits Required for Nighttime Photography in Yosemite?
Commercial or organized shoots may require permits from the National Park Service. Personal photography for non-commercial use is generally allowed, but check current park regulations and seasonal restrictions. Always confirm with official sources to avoid fines and ensure compliance.
How Can I Reduce Noise When Stacking Star Images?
Shoot many short exposures at moderate ISO to avoid sensor heating. Use dark frames and calibration frames when stacking, and apply noise reduction during processing. Stacking software averages noise across frames, improving signal-to-noise while preserving star movement and Milky Way detail.
